Judith Consalvo

Judith Consalvo serves as a Program Analyst in the Center for Outcomes and Evidence at the Agency for Healthcare Research and Quality (AHRQ). She is the program liaison for the Centers for Education and Research on Therapeutics (CERTs) and the project officer for the CERT Coordinating Center. Ms. Consalvo also serves as the program liaison for the TRIP II (translating research into practice) effort, a grants project officer, and the coordinator of AHRQ's Continuing Medical Education Program.

Ms. Consalvo graduated from the University of Maryland with a degree in Psychology and pursued graduate studies in Counseling Psychology. Previously, she was coordinator of the Primary Care Research Fellowship program at Georgetown University School of Medicine.
